    Crash Bandicoot 4: It’s About Time smashes wumpa fruits on next-gen consoles today

    Today marks the day our bandicoot fellow invades the next-generation of consoles — the PS5 and Xbox Series X|S.

    Crash Bandicoot 4: It’s About Time takes advantage of the PS5 and next-gen Xbox’s higher wumpa juice level to upgrade its visuals, faster load times, overall 60 frames per second, and 4K resolution. To even spice up this next-gen version launch, PS5 owners with 3D audio-capable headsets are in for a treat and as well as those spatial audio-capable headsets for Xbox Series X|S owners.

    To make a short list of new features, here you go:

    PS5
    – Free upgrade if you’re an existing owner of the PS4 version
    – 3D audio
    – Faster load times
    – 4K, 60 frames per second
    – DualSense adaptive triggers and haptic feedback
    – Activity Card

    Xbox Series X|S
    – Faster load times
    – 4K, 60 frames per second for Series X
    – Upscaled to 4K, 60 frames per second for Series S
    – Smart Delivery

    Aside from these next-gen bad boys, Nintendo Switch players can also buy the game for their console too!

    Crash Bandicoot 4: It’s About Time was reviewed by Erickson Melchor here on Sirus Gaming, stating “is equal parts fun and frustrating”.

    Crash Bandicoot 4: It’s About time is now available on PS5, Xbox Series X|S, and Nintendo Switch for only $59.99, with the PC version via Battle.net starts its pre-order at an SRP of $39.99. The game is also available on PS4 and Xbox One.
